1. 进入到自建文件夹,进入cmd,创建demo01项目
2.cd进入新建的项目demo01文件夹,然后输入pyhon manage.py runserver 8002
注意:这里更改了默认的端口8000为8002,是为了避免和第一个helloworld项目端口重复
备注:ctrl+c可以结束服务器,这里暂时不结束
3. 用pycharm打开demo01文件夹,并在文件夹下新建views.py
4. 在views.py文件内输入:
from django.http import HttpResponse
def hello(request):
return HttpResponse("Hello world ! ")
5. 然后在urls.py文件中覆盖输入:
from django.urls import path
from . import views
urlpatterns = [
path('hello/', views.hello),
]
整个过程如何理解:
1. 在cmd中 manage.py启动项目
2.在地址栏中输送hello/
3.地址也就是路由会自动访问 urls.py文件
4.在urls.py文件中搜索路径为hello的路径,找到了一个,其映射的对象为views.hello
5.自然就会访问views.py文件,并且调用其中的hello函数
6.hello函数response的内容是 hello world 就是我们呈现的内容